It is shown that, by incorporating fast on-line recursive identifiers to provide updated step-response matrices for inclusion in digital PID control laws, highly effective adaptive digital set-point tracking controllers can be readily designed for multivariable plants. The effectiveness of such an adaptive controller is illustrated by the design of an adaptive direct digital flight-mode control system for the F-16 aircraft.
